After Upgrading to Java 9 or Later, the Deploy Server Fails to Start with "Could not create the Java Virtual Machine"

Troubleshooting


Problem

The IBM DevOps (UrbanCode) Deploy server fails to start after upgrading to Java 9 or later.

Symptom

When starting the Deploy server, it fails with an error: "Could not create the Java Virtual Machine".
For Example:
 Server\bin> run_server

OpenJDK 64-Bit Server VM warning: Ignoring option MaxPermSize; support was removed in 8.0 -Djava.endorsed.dirs=D:\ibm-ucd\endorsed is not supported. Endorsed standards and standalone APIs in modular form will be supported via the concept of upgradeable modules.
 
Error: Could not create the Java Virtual Machine.
Error: A fatal exception has occurred. Program will exit.
